[iphone] Xcode 4에서 iPhone 앱 이름 변경

iPhone 화면에서 앱 아이콘 아래에 표시되는 이름을 변경하고 싶습니다. Xcode 4를 사용하고 키가있는 대상이 하나 있습니다.

  • 번들 표시 이름 : $ {PRODUCT_NAME}
  • 번들 이름 : $ {PRODUCT_NAME}

내 프로젝트 이름은 예를 들어 “test”이지만 “MySuperApp”을 갖고 싶습니다. 그렇다면 어디에서 가장 잘 변경할 수 있습니까? 바꿀 수있는 곳이 ${PRODUCT_NAME}있나요?

변경해야하는 다른 장소가 있습니까?



답변

파일 이름 변경없이 응답

참고 파일 이름 변경을 필요로하지 않는 대답은 다음과 같습니다 .

파일 이름 바꾸기로 응답

좋아, 여기에 내가 찾은 것이 있습니다.이 게시물을 읽은 후 약간의 사냥을 가져 갔 으므로이 답변이 모든 사람에게 도움이되기를 바랍니다.

1. 왼쪽의 프로젝트 콘텐츠 창에서 폴더 아이콘을 클릭합니다.

폴더 아이콘

2. 프로젝트를 나타내는 최상위 파란색 선을 선택합니다.

프로젝트 아이콘

3. Inspector 창 (오른쪽 창)이 열려 있지 않으면 단추를 클릭하여 활성화합니다. 이것은 “보기”도구 모음의 오른쪽 상단 모서리에있는 세 번째 버튼입니다.

"보기"의 ​​세 번째 버튼

4. Inspector 창에서 모서리가 접힌 종이 (파일 속성) 아이콘을 클릭합니다.

파일 검사기

5. 첫 번째는 프로젝트 이름입니다. 새 파일을 입력하면 프로젝트 콘텐츠 파일의 이름을 변경하라는 메시지가 표시됩니다.

프로젝트 이름 필드

추가해야합니다. 이렇게하면 이전 앱이 시뮬레이터에 원래 이름으로 남아 있으므로 시뮬레이터에서 삭제해야합니다. 또한 이전 앱 번들에서 생성 한 파일은 새 번들로 전달되지 않습니다 (Finder에서 찾아서 이동하지 않는 한).

(편집하다 🙂 하나 더 중요한 메모. 번들 이름을 변경하면 Apple 프로비저닝 포털에 등록한 App Bundle 식별자가 더 이상 해당 앱에서 작동하지 않습니다. 앱을 물리적 장치에 배포하려면 새 앱 ID와 프로비저닝 프로필을 생성해야합니다.


답변

Xcode 4에서 대상, “정보”탭을 선택하고 “번들 표시 이름”필드를 원하는 이름 (예 : “MySuperApp”)으로 설정합니다. 이것은 가장 간단하고 고통이없는 솔루션입니다.

여기에 설명 된 다른 모든 답변은 원래 게시 된 문제를 해결하지 않습니다. “iPhone 화면의 앱 아이콘 아래에 표시되는 이름을 변경하고 싶습니다.” 의 upvoted 답변 : 우디, 제이, 그리고 youshunei 확인을하지만 그들은 모든 변화 표시된 이름 중 :

A) App Bundle Identifier를 변경하면 앱과 Apple Provisioning Portal에 등록한 Bundle Identifier간에 비 호환성이 발생합니다 (이미 앱을 배포했거나 앱을 제출하려는 경우 문제가 됨).

또는

B) 다른 사람들이 언급 한 체계 문제가 발생합니다 (즉, 기존 체계를 삭제 / 재 작성해야 함).


답변

대상 설정 페이지의 빌드 탭에서 변경하십시오.

설명 : 대상 선택, 빌드중인 대상 선택, 정보 가져 오기, 빌드 탭 선택, 검색 상자에 ‘제품 이름’쓰기 및 변경.


답변

Xcode 4에서 TARGETS 이름을 두 번 클릭하고 (두 번 클릭하지 않음) 이름을 변경하고 Xcode를 다시 시작합니다. 그것은 나를 위해 일했습니다. 간단합니다.
여기에 이미지 설명 입력


답변

프로젝트 .plist 에서 번들 표시 이름을 변경하려고합니다 .

Bundle display name : ${PRODUCT_NAME}   

로 변경되어야합니다

Bundle display name : MySuperApp

이것은 실제로 앱 식별자를 변경하지 않고 iOS의 아이콘 레이블을 변경합니다. 번들 표시 이름 만 변경하면 새 앱 ID 및 프로비저닝 프로필을 설정할 필요가 없습니다.


답변

제품 이름 변경 : “대상”바로 아래에있는 이름을 두 번 클릭하고 원하는대로 대상 이름을 수정합니다.

변경 여부 확인 : “대상”을 클릭하고 오른쪽에서 “빌드 설정”에서 “제품 이름”을 검색합니다. 표시된 제품 이름 값은 변경 사항을 반영해야합니다. 그렇지 않은 경우 해당 이름을 두 번 클릭하여 $ (TARGET_NAME)로 설정되어 있는지 확인하십시오.


답변

  1. 프로젝트 선택
  2. 대상을 선택하고 한 번 클릭하여 편집하고 이름을 바꾸면 완료됩니다.
  3. 제품 이름이 변경되는 것을 볼 수 있습니다.

여기이 3 단계의 스냅

여기에 이미지 설명 입력

편집 :
게시물 후 youshunei의 이미지 첨부와 유사한 답변을 발견했습니다. 따라서 여기에 Xcode 6.3.2에서 테스트 한 정보를 조금 더 추가하고 다시 시작할 필요가 없습니다.

편집 됨 : 같은 방식으로 이름에 쉼표
가 포함 된 Mac OS X 앱 중 하나의 이름을 변경 했습니다. 일부 포드 링크 라이브러리에 누락 된 파일 (쉼표로 잘린 이름)이 있습니다. 따라서 Target-> Build Settings-> Product Name 에서 내 앱의 이름을 변경해야합니다.